Robinhood has fundamentally altered the retail investing landscape by permitting users to delegate stock trading and credit card payment execution to artificial intelligence agents. This initiative allows customers to link external AI tools, including Claude and Cursor, directly to their brokerage accounts via an API-style interface. Currently, the operational scope is restricted to equity transactions, though the firm has confirmed that options trading and cryptocurrency support are scheduled for subsequent deployment phases. This strategic pivot places the platform at the convergence of retail finance and autonomous agent technology, moving beyond traditional robo-advisors to enable third-party reasoning engines to act on user-defined parameters.
The mechanism relies on users authorizing specific agents to operate within strict boundaries, such as defined risk tolerance, investment objectives, and spending caps. Unlike static algorithms, these agents execute actions based on their own internal logic and real-time market data. Data compiled by Woofun AI indicates that this architecture represents a distinct shift from passive portfolio management to active, autonomous decision-making by external software entities. The initial limitation to equity trades serves as a controlled environment to validate the security and efficacy of these autonomous interactions before expanding into more complex asset classes.
The planned integration of options and cryptocurrencies marks a critical expansion of the agent's potential utility and operational complexity. Options trading introduces leverage and time-decay variables, while crypto markets operate on a 24/7 cycle with heightened volatility, creating a dynamic testing ground for automated strategies. Woofun AI notes that enabling agents to navigate these unregulated or lightly regulated assets could accelerate the adoption of sophisticated trading tactics among retail investors who previously lacked the technical expertise to execute them manually.
However, this expansion also amplifies the potential for unintended trading behaviors and systemic risks.

The implications for accountability and security are profound as autonomous systems gain the authority to move capital without constant human oversight. Users must carefully evaluate the permissions granted to these agents and the safeguards implemented to prevent erroneous or malicious executions. Woofun AI analysis suggests that the combination of autonomous agents and volatile crypto assets could create new risk vectors that traditional financial regulations have not yet addressed. As the feature evolves, the industry will closely monitor how these systems handle market stress and whether the defined parameters effectively contain potential losses.
